BRG experts within our Business Insurance Claims (BIC) practice are often retained after a catastrophe to provide advice and guidance to the policyholder in the recovery process and to prepare claims. Our experts analyze detailed financial and accounting records and operations data; develop financial models to assess losses; and prepare insurance claims that are comprehensive and well documented, and support resolution and payment of complex claims.

The BIC practice is looking for a highly skilled, motivated problem solver with robust financial analytical ability, strong organizational skills, and a desire to advance within a consulting environment. The ideal candidate will have prior experience in financial auditing, forensic accounting, economic consulting or commercial litigation damages analyses. The work will involve both preparation and review of work product that may be either quantitative or qualitative in nature and providing high quality client service. Projects range from developing complex financial models, preparing supportable and detailed loss calculations, and drafting reports for litigation matters and large business insurance claims, among other forms of financial analyses.
